This book is well written and printed, containing good illustrations. It deals with the technic of actual physical therapy of children with cerebral palsy. It discusses clearly and in detail many of the modalities employed. These include massage, passive motion, active and active associated motion, resistant motion, automatic and conditioned motion, relaxation, balance work, and some of the skills. There is also included a list of various types of equipment which can be employed for the cerebral palsied.
